So there is a really bad knock in my front suspension and I think/ assume its my upper ball joint as we all know they go bad all the time. Here is my question. If it costs $300 to replace the upper ball joints and jeepin by al's upper a arms cost (something around $300) Is it worth it to just get the a-arms? Do these new a-arms really fix the ball joint problem? PS I have a 2.5 frankenlift2. Im not sure what to do.

1- if your UBJs are making a KNOCK then it's terribly unsafe to drive

Would suggest checking the UBA's via method posted in one of the stickied threads

typical after-lift noises often come from upper plate nuts that did not get loctite or torqued correctly so check those too


if you do find that youre in need of UBJ's, in my personal opinion yes the jba uca's were worth it, my vehicle drives better after the replacement than it did lifted with stock uca's and the alignment is dead on

plus the serviceable joints, something you wont get from simply replacing with OEM UCA's was worth the extra $ in part costs to me

The JBA arms will correct the ball joint angle. Plus you can replace the ball joints in 20 minutes and for under 50 bucks when the time comes again.......
